Johannesburg - A man was arrested in Midrand on Tuesday after he allegedly stabbed another man several times, reportedly during an argument.
Midrand police spokesperson Constable Mamote Tlamela told News24 that police received a complaint around 08:40 about the attack at the corner of Le Roux and Morkel streets.
"Upon the arrival at the scene they met... [an] eyewitness who pointed out the suspect, who he saw stabbing the victim several times with a knife," Tlamela said.
"The police approached the suspect who handed himself [over]. The suspect also handed the knife he [allegedly] used to stab the victim with to the police."
The 18-year-old will appear in court soon on charges of attempted murder.
Paramedics said the 34-year-old victim was rushed to hospital in a critical condition.
"Reports from the scene indicate that two men started arguing when one man assaulted the other man," Netcare 911 spokesperson Santi Steinmann said.
